WebSelect a location by clicking on the Google map or by using the the search box. This will set the first marker. Click on the map again or enter another search to set the second marker. A minimum of two markers are required to measure distance and a minimum of three markers to measure an area. All markers can be dragged on the map as required. WebFollow these steps to lay your stones. Step 1. Dig a trench. Dig a trench about 8" (200 mm) wide by 7" (175 mm) deep. A 2" to 3" (50 mm to 75 mm) bed of concrete is sufficient for laying light edging kerbs, so that allows 2" to 3" of the edging (for 7" edging" to project above the surface when placed on top of the bed. khand online
